Introduction:
Following tradition, the 10th International Cloud Modeling Workshop (ICMW) was planned to be
held at the Indian Institute of Tropical Meteorology (IITM) in Pune, India in July 2020, the week
before the International Conference on Clouds and Precipitation (ICCP). Due to the COVID-19
pandemic, both ICMW and ICCP were postponed to 2021 and held online. For the 10th ICMW,
more than 120 cloud modeling researchers from all around the world met online through the
gather.town platform from 26 - 30 July 2021 to discuss recent progress and challenges in
modeling dynamics-microphysics interactions.
